What Are Braces for Teenagers?

Braces for teenagers serve as orthodontic devices designed to correct various dental misalignments. They consist of several components, including brackets, wires, and elastic bands, which work together to gradually shift teeth into their proper positions. These appliances cater to a variety of needs, from simple cosmetic enhancements to addressing more complex bite issues. Whether your teenager needs traditional metal braces, ceramic options, or clear aligners, the primary goal remains the same: to create a healthy, functional smile.

Types of Braces Available in Hawthorn

In Hawthorn, there are multiple braces options tailored to meet the specific needs and preferences of teenagers:

  • Metal Braces: The most common type, these are durable and designed to effectively correct a wide range of orthodontic issues.
  • Ceramic Braces: A more aesthetically pleasing option, ceramic braces blend with the natural color of teeth, making them less noticeable.
  • Lingual Braces: These are placed on the back of the teeth, providing an invisible treatment option while still delivering effective results.
  • Clear Aligners: Brands like Invisalign offer a removable solution that progressively shifts teeth without the need for fixed brackets.

Assessing When to Start Orthodontic Treatment

Recommended Age for Initial Consultations

While some may think treatment should begin only in the teenage years, the Australian Society of Orthodontists recommends that children have their first orthodontic assessment by age 7. This early assessment allows orthodontists to identify potential issues that could complicate future treatment. For teenagers nearing this age, a follow-up visit is vital for determining the best time to commence braces.

Signs Your Teen Needs Braces

Parents should be vigilant for signs that may indicate the need for braces, including:

  • Teeth that appear overcrowded or crooked
  • Misalignment of the bite, such as overbites or underbites
  • Difficulty in chewing or biting
  • Teeth that are wearing down unevenly
  • Prolonged thumb sucking or other oral habits

The Process of Getting Braces

Initial Consultation and Assessment Steps

The journey towards achieving a straight smile begins with an initial consultation. During this visit, the orthodontist will evaluate your teenager’s dental health, take necessary X-rays, and create a comprehensive treatment plan. This stage is crucial for ensuring a personalized approach that meets your child’s specific needs.

Understanding the Fitting Process

Once treatment is confirmed, the fitting process typically involves cleaning the teeth, applying brackets, and threading the archwire. This process is quick and efficient, aiming to minimize discomfort while ensuring that the braces are secure and comfortable. Parents are encouraged to ask questions to understand better how the appliances work.

Adjustments and Monitoring Progress

Regular adjustments will be scheduled to monitor your teenager’s progress and make any necessary changes to the braces. These appointments are critical as they ensure the teeth are moving as planned and may include tightening of wires or changing elastic bands. Maintaining open communication with the orthodontist during this phase enhances the overall treatment experience.

FAQs on Braces for Teenagers in Hawthorn

How long does treatment typically take?

On average, treatment with braces can take anywhere from 18 months to 3 years, depending on the complexity of the case. Regular visits to the orthodontist can help expedite this process by ensuring everything is on track.

Are braces painful during the adjustment process?

Patients may experience mild discomfort following adjustments, but this typically subsides within a few days. Over-the-counter pain relievers can help manage any discomfort during this time.

What are the risks associated with braces?

While braces are generally safe, some risks may include tooth decay, gum inflammation, and issues related to oral hygiene. Regular dental cleaning is essential to minimize these risks.

Can teenagers participate in sports with braces?

Yes, teenagers can participate in sports while wearing braces, but it’s advisable to use a mouthguard to protect the braces and teeth from injury during contact sports.

What care is required for braces during treatment?

Maintaining good oral hygiene is crucial for those with braces. Regular brushing, flossing, and routine dental check-ups are essential to keep teeth and gums healthy throughout the treatment process.
